It doesn't have fetch or clone support, but perhaps my poorman's submodule code will help you a bit, until real submodule support appears in git. http://marc2.theaimsgroup.com/?l=git&m=116662031219222&w=2 I've found it useful for myself, and with a little bit of massaging I don't think it would be hard to put fetch support in. I think it just needs a way of telling the remote end to switch GIT_DIR to a different directory. "Merges" are handled by simply sorting out any conflicts in the module file (basically you pick one of the submodule commits) just as you would with any other file.
